How to Make the Easiest and Fastest Crochet Socks

Crochet socks don’t have to be complicated. With the right yarn, hook, and a simple stitch pattern, you can create cozy socks in just a few hours. This method uses a flat crochet technique worked from the cuff to the toe, then seamed—no complex heel turns needed.


Materials You’ll Need

  • Yarn:

    • Lightweight (Category 3) or Sock/Fingering yarn

    • Choose yarn with stretch or wool blend for comfort

  • Crochet Hook:

    • Size 3.5 mm–4.5 mm (adjust based on your tension)

  • Scissors

  • Yarn needle (for sewing seams)

  • Measuring tape


Best Stitch for Fast Socks

The Half Double Crochet (HDC) or Single Crochet (SC) in the back loop only (BLO) is ideal because:

  • It creates stretchy fabric

  • Works up quickly

  • Looks neat and cozy


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 1: Make the Cuff

  1. Chain enough stitches to fit comfortably around your ankle.

    • Usually 10–15 chains for adults.

  2. Turn and work HDC or SC in the back loop only.

  3. Continue crocheting rows until the strip wraps snugly around your ankle.

  4. Slip stitch or sew the ends together to form a cuff.

✔️ This ribbed cuff gives stretch without elastic.


Step 2: Crochet the Foot (Lengthwise)

  1. After joining the cuff, begin working rows along the length of your foot.

  2. Crochet back and forth using the same stitch.

  3. Measure as you go and stop when it reaches the base of your toes.

📏 Tip: Try it on often for the perfect fit.


Step 3: Shape the Toe (Fast Method)

  1. Fold the sock flat.

  2. Sew across the toe edge using a yarn needle.

  3. Pull tight and fasten off.

No toe decreases required—simple and fast!


Step 4: Seam the Sock

  1. Fold the sock with right sides together.

  2. Sew the length seam from toe to cuff.

  3. Turn the sock right side out.

Repeat the process for the second sock.

Tips for Perfect Crochet Socks

  • Use smaller hooks for tighter, durable stitches

  • Choose stretchy yarn

  • Crochet slightly snug—socks loosen with wear

  • Try ankle-length first before longer socks
